Package: bash-completion
Version: 1:1.99-3
Severity: normal
Tags: patch
Dear Maintainer,
aptitude safe-upgrade accepts package name as parameters, the following patch
enable bash completion for it :
--- a/completions/aptitude 2012-05-17 09:33:19.449845569 +0200
+++ b/completions/aptitude 2012-05-17 09:39:49.229833983 +0200
@@ -28,7 +28,7 @@
local special i
for (( i=0; i < ${#words[@]}-1; i++ )); do
- if [[ ${words[i]} ==
@(@(|re)install|@(|un)hold|@(|un)markauto|@(dist|full)-upgrade|download|show|forbid-version|purge|remove|changelog|why@(|-not)|keep@(|-all)|build-dep|@(add|remove)-user-tag|versions)
]]; then
+ if [[ ${words[i]} ==
@(@(|re)install|@(|un)hold|@(|un)markauto|@(dist|full|safe)-upgrade|download|show|forbid-version|purge|remove|changelog|why@(|-not)|keep@(|-all)|build-dep|@(add|remove)-user-tag|versions)
]]; then
special=${words[i]}
fi
#exclude some mutually exclusive options
@@ -40,7 +40,7 @@
case $special in
install|hold|markauto|unmarkauto|dist-upgrade|full-upgrade| \
download|show|changelog|why|why-not|build-dep|add-user-tag| \
- remove-user-tag|versions)
+ remove-user-tag|versions|safe-upgrade)
COMPREPLY=( $( apt-cache pkgnames $cur 2> /dev/null ) )
return 0
;;
@@ -58,7 +58,7 @@
case $prev in
# don't complete anything if these options are found
- autoclean|clean|forget-new|search|safe-upgrade|upgrade|update|keep-all)
+ autoclean|clean|forget-new|search|upgrade|update|keep-all)
return 0
;;
-S)
